5 | 7 | | A BILL TO BE ENTITLED |
---|
6 | 8 | | AN ACT |
---|
7 | 9 | | relating to the award of health plan provider contracts under the |
---|
8 | 10 | | Medicaid managed care program. |
---|
9 | 11 | | B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: |
---|
10 | 12 | | SECTION 1. Section 533.004(a), Government Code, is amended |
---|
11 | 13 | | to read as follows: |
---|
12 | 14 | | (a) In providing health care services through Medicaid |
---|
13 | 15 | | managed care to recipients in a health care service region, the |
---|
14 | 16 | | commission shall contract with a managed care organization in that |
---|
15 | 17 | | region that is licensed under Chapter 843, Insurance Code, if |
---|
16 | 18 | | subject to that chapter, to provide health care in that region and |
---|
17 | 19 | | that is: |
---|
18 | 20 | | (1) wholly owned and operated by a hospital district |
---|
19 | 21 | | in that region; |
---|
20 | 22 | | (2) created by a nonprofit corporation that: |
---|
21 | 23 | | (A) has a contract, agreement, or other |
---|
22 | 24 | | arrangement with a hospital district in that region or with a |
---|
23 | 25 | | municipality in that region that owns a hospital licensed under |
---|
24 | 26 | | Chapter 241, Health and Safety Code, and has an obligation to |
---|
25 | 27 | | provide health care to indigent patients; and |
---|
26 | 28 | | (B) under the contract, agreement, or other |
---|
27 | 29 | | arrangement, assumes the obligation to provide health care to |
---|
28 | 30 | | indigent patients and leases, manages, or operates a hospital |
---|
29 | 31 | | facility owned by the hospital district or municipality; [or] |
---|
30 | 32 | | (3) created by a nonprofit corporation that has a |
---|
31 | 33 | | contract, agreement, or other arrangement with a hospital district |
---|
32 | 34 | | in that region under which the nonprofit corporation acts as an |
---|
33 | 35 | | agent of the district and assumes the district's obligation to |
---|
34 | 36 | | arrange for services under the Medicaid expansion for children as |
---|
35 | 37 | | authorized by Chapter 444, Acts of the 74th Legislature, Regular |
---|
36 | 38 | | Session, 1995; or |
---|
37 | 39 | | (4) if the commission does not have an existing |
---|
38 | 40 | | contract with a managed care organization in a health care service |
---|
39 | 41 | | region under Subdivision (1), (2), or (3) on September 1, 2021, |
---|
40 | 42 | | wholly owned by a provider-sponsored health organization that owns |
---|
41 | 43 | | and operates: |
---|
42 | 44 | | (A) two trauma facilities designated as level I |
---|
43 | 45 | | trauma facilities by the Department of State Health Services under |
---|
44 | 46 | | Section 773.115, Health and Safety Code, that are located in |
---|
45 | 47 | | different trauma service areas; and |
---|
46 | 48 | | (B) a hospital licensed under Chapter 241, Health |
---|
47 | 49 | | and Safety Code, that is located in the health care service region. |
---|
48 | 50 | | SECTION 2. The changes in law made by this Act apply only to |
---|
49 | 51 | | the award of a contract by the Health and Human Services Commission |
---|
50 | 52 | | on or after the effective date of this Act. |
---|
51 | 53 | | SECTION 3. If before implementing any provision of this Act |
---|
52 | 54 | | a state agency determines that a waiver or authorization from a |
---|
53 | 55 | | federal agency is necessary for implementation of that provision, |
---|
54 | 56 | | the agency affected by the provision shall request the waiver or |
---|
55 | 57 | | authorization and may delay implementing that provision until the |
---|
56 | 58 | | waiver or authorization is granted. |
---|
57 | 59 | | SECTION 4. This Act takes effect immediately if it receives |
---|
58 | 60 | | a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as |
---|
59 | 61 | | prov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ution. If this |
---|
60 | 62 | |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this |
---|
61 | 63 | | Act takes effect September 1, 2021. |
